FCI Manager Important Books: The FCI has released the official notification for the FCI Manager 2022 recruitment on the 24th of August, 2022. The online registration process has begun on the 27th of August and will close on the 26th of September, 2022. Candidates will be looking to fast-track their preparation for the Phase I FCI Manager 2022.

FCI Manager requires thorough preparation and a streamlined study strategy. This includes study material that best helps in covering the essential topics in an easily understandable manner. It is important to keep in mind that having too many books can cause confusion and can even mess up the flow of preparation. Here, we have provided a section-wise list of books that will be great study material to cover all topics and make your preparation smooth.

FCI Manager Exam Pattern

The following is the exam pattern for Phase I of the FCI Manager 2022 exam.

Sr.
No
Name of the TestNo. of
Qs
.
Max. MarksDuration
(minutes)
Medium of
examination
1English Language252515 minutesEnglish
2Reasoning Ability252515 minutesBilingual (English and Hindi)
3Numerical Aptitude252515 minutesBilingual (English and Hindi)
4General Studies252515 minutesBilingual (English and Hindi)
  Total10010060 Minutes

1. Important Books for English Language Section

First, take a look at the topics being covered for the English language section.

Reading ComprehensionSentence Improvement
Cloze TestPhrase Replacement
Error SpottingAntonyms Synonyms
Para JumblesIdioms and Phrases
Fillers – Single, DoubleOne-Word Substitution
Verbal Ability

The following are the important books to refer to for the English Language section of FCI Manager 2022.

Book Title Author
Objective General EnglishS.P. Bakshi
High School English Grammar and CompositionWren and Martin
Quick Learning Objective EnglishR S Aggarwal
Word Power Made EasyNorman Lewis

2. Important Books for Reasoning Ability Section

Following are the topics covered for FCI Manager 2022 in the Reasoning Ability Section.

Arrangement and PatternDirection and Distance
AnalogyInequalities
ClassificationPuzzles
SeriesVerbal Reasoning
Coding and DecodingInput-Output
Blood RelationsOrder Ranking
Seating ArrangementSyllogisms
Alphanumeric SeriesLogical Reasoning

Here are the best books to use for the Reasoning Ability section of the FCI Manager 2022 Phase I Exam.

Book NameAuthor
Verbal and Non-Verbal Reasoning R S Aggarwal
A New Approach to ReasoningB.S. Sijwali & S. Sijwali Arihant
Analytical ReasoningM.K Pandey
Data Interpretation and Data Sufficiency Arihant Publication

3. Important Books for Numerical Aptitude Section

Let’s take a look at the topics that need to be covered for the Numerical Aptitude section.

Data InterpretationRatio & Proportion
Number SeriesPercentages
Quadratic EquationsProfit & Loss
Data SufficiencyAverages, Mixtures & Alligation
Problems on AgesSimple Interest & Compound Interest
PartnershipsWork & Time
MensurationTime, Speed & Distance
Permutation & CombinationProbability
SimplificationNumber System
MensurationAlgebra

These are the best books to refer to while preparing for the Numerical Ability section of the FCI Manager 2022 Phase I exam.

Book NameAuthor
Quantitative Aptitude for Competitive ExaminationR S Aggarwal
Fast Track Objective ArithmeticArihant Publications
Quantum CATSarvesh Sharma
Quantitative Aptitude for CATArun Sharma

4. Important Books for General Studies Section

General Studies is a new section introduced by FCI for the FCI Manager 2022 Phase I and Phase II Exams. These are the important topics to keep in mind while preparing this section.

Indian HistoryIndian Economy
GeographyGeneral Science
Current Affairs

Here are a few must-have books while preparing for the General Studies section of the FCI Manager 2022 Phase I exam.

Book NameAuthor
General Studies with 14,000+ Objective QuestionsArihant Publications
General KnowledgeLucent
Objective Question Bank from General ScienceArihant Publications
Manorma Yearbook (for Current Affairs)Manorama

What is the salary for FCI Manager 2022?

An FCI Manager will get a monthly salary in the range of 40,000-1,40,000. Read up on the FCI Manager 2022 post-wise pay scale here.

What are the qualification criteria for FCI Manager 2022?

FCI Manager official notification details the qualification details for various managerial posts under FCI. These posts are mainly General, Accounts, Depot, Movement, Accounts, Technical (Civil, Electrical, and Mechanical Engineering), and Manager (Hindi).
